POTENTIAL AND DEVELOPEMENT STRATEGY OF MANGROVE ECOTOURISM IN SUNGAI RAWA VILLAGE SIAK REGENCY RIAU PROVINCE Oktarina, Ayu; Mulyadi, Aras; Yoswaty, Dessy

ABSTRACT Mangrove ecotourism is an effort to maintain and utilize mangroves. This research was conducted in Sungai Rawa Village, Siak Regency, Riau Province, in September 2019. The objectives of this study were to: 1). Knowing the potential of mangrove ecosystems in Sungai Rawa Village to be developed into a mangrove ecotourism destination, 2). Develop strategies for developing mangrove ecotourism in Sungai Rawa Village. The method used in this study is a survey method. The sampling points and the respondents were determined by the purposive sampling method. The mangrove forest of Sungai Rawa Village has the potential to be developed as a mangrove ecotourism area with good ecological conditions of the mangrove forest, has a high diversity of biota, research and conservation potential as well as a high level of security and hospitality for the community. Community participation in the development of ecotourism in Sungai Rawa Village is classified as low with an IPR value of -0.03 and Mean calculated value of 1.99 while community perceptions about ecotourism development in swamp river villages are high with an IPR value of 2.77 and an average value at 26.65. Based on stakeholder perceptions of the development of Sungai Rawa Village ecotourism is appropriate or feasible to be developed as an ecotourism area. Strategy in developing mangrove ecotourism in Sungai Rawa Village is to implement an aggressive strategy (Growth Oriented Strategy) by prioritizing SO strategies, namely: 1) Establishing mangrove forest areas in Sungai Rawa Village as a conservation area, 2) Increasing access to a wider market, 3) Building collaboration with related agencies and institutions. Keyword: Siak, Ecotourism, Mangrove
PEMBUATAN KATALIS BERBASIS KARBON AKTIF DARI TEMPURUNG KELAPA (Cocos nucifera) DIIMPREGNASI KOH PADA REAKSI TRANSESTERIFIKASI SINTESIS BIODIESEL Zamhari, Mustain; Junaidi, Robert; Rachmatika, Nisa; Oktarina, Ayu

The Research has been carried out on KOH catalyst/activated carbon as a heterogeneous base catalyst with the impregnation method to be applied in making biodiesel from used cooking oil. Activated carbon from coconut shell carbonized in a furnace at 500oC for 4 hours. After that, activated carbon was impregnated in a KOH solution with a concentration of 1 N, 2N, 3 N, 4 N, and 5 N for 18,21 and 24 hours. Catalyst is analyzed with AAS (Atomic Absorption Spectrophotometry) to see the content of potassium absorbed in the activated carbon. Analyzed SEM (Scanning Electron Microscopy) to see the characteristics of the catalyst that has been produced. Best condition which produced the catalyst with the highest potassium content after impregnation is 97.00% was obtained at a concentration of 5 N KOH with an impregnation time of 21 hours. Making biodiesel, variations of catalyst 1,3, and 5% are carried out with a reaction temperature of 45,55,65,75oC,cooking oil:methanol ratio of 1:6. The best biodiesel is obtained from a catalyst 3% at 55oC with a yield of 87.72%. Characteriszation of methyl ester product fulfill standart of biodiesel viscosity 4.7622 gr/ml, denistas 0.8709 gr/ml, acid number 1.4027 mgKOH/g, water content 0.0266%, flash point 176oC.
